Abstract
The invention discloses a kind of corn and the high yield cultivating method of garlic interplanting, it is related to agricultural plantation technology field, comprises the following steps:(1), Fruit variety;(2), selection of land site preparation;(3), Seed Treatment;(4), open plantation ditch;(5), begin sowing in good time;(6), field management;(7), harvesting.It is of the invention effectively to avoid the defect of respective presence rationally using garlic and the advantage of corn, on the basis of garlic production promoting, interplanting corn, while improving the quality and yield of corn and garlic.

The content of the invention
It is an object of the invention to provide a kind of corn and the high yield cultivating method of garlic interplanting, garlic and corn are rationally utilized
Advantage, effectively avoid the defect of respective presence, on the basis of garlic production promoting, interplanting corn, while improving corn and big
The quality and yield of garlic.
The invention provides following technical scheme:The high yield cultivating method that a kind of corn is interplanted with garlic, including it is as follows
Step:
(1), Fruit variety:
Garlic cultivar:From high-quality, high yield, the kind of strong stress resistance;
Corn variety:From grain, the cenospecies seed of big, full, tool breediness makees seed, removes scab grain, worm food grain, breaks
Damage grain, mix grain and impurity;
(2), selection of land site preparation:
Select that fertile, soil layer is deep, loose, excessively drained field, it is preceding harvest after remove root stubble in time, deep plough 20 ~ 30cm,
Make that grogs is in small, broken bits, soil is soft, Land leveling, topsoil it is steady and sure;
(3), Seed Treatment:
Corn seed treatment:It is coated using corn seed-dressing agent special, seed coat agent is formed uniform thin in corn seed outer layer
Film, after preparation sowing after film hardening;
Garlic Seed Treatment:The precooling of garlic seed is lowered the temperature 7~10 days, and temperature is down to 0~5 DEG C, carries out low-temperature treatment, then by garlic
Seed is removed the peel, and is invaded with 50% carbendazol wettable powder, 500 times of liquid after peeling and planted 1 ~ 2 hour, pulls the preparation sowing that drains away the water out;
(4), open plantation ditch:
Ditched in cultivating bed side or ditched with gutter tool, deep 3 ~ 4cm, then the second bar ditch are opened by 0.3 ~ 0.4m of line-spacing, with the
Two bar ditch soil the first bar ditch of covering, are sequentially carried out according to this, and furrow face of being raked after finishing pours permeable;
(5), begin sowing in good time:Garlic is sowed in late August to early September, depth of planting be 2 ~ 2.5cm, 13~15cm of spacing in the rows,
Garlic clove bud is pressed into ditch in wet soil upward, the direction of garlic clove back of the body linea ventralis is gone to consistent with sowing;Corn is sowed by the end of April, strain
Away from 30 ~ 35cm, 3500~3550 plants every mu, earthing after emerging, rake;
(6), field management:
Spray herbicide and covering with plastic film:After cultivating bed or ridge leveling, every mu of pendimethalin missible oil 150ml of use 33% sprays to water
Spill, timely covering film after sprinkling;
Topdress:Row dry one Garlic Fertilization ditch in the middle of two row garlics, applies garlic special fertilizer, after fertilising that soil time is flat, in corn
Corn fertilizing ditch is drawn at 2 ~ 5cm of plantation ditch, corn fertilizer is applied, it is after fertilising that soil time is flat;
(7), harvesting:Harvested after maturation.
Preferably, the step(2)Base manure is sowed during middle deep ploughing.
Preferably, the base manure by weight, including 100 ~ 120 parts of thin ashes, become thoroughly decomposed 80 ~ 90 parts of animal waste,
10 ~ 20 parts of 30 ~ 40 parts of urea, excessively 30 ~ 40 parts of turf, 10 ~ 20 parts of calcium superphosphate, 10 ~ 20 parts of potassium chloride and soil conditioner.
Preferably, the soil conditioner by weight, including 30 ~ 40 parts of mushroom residue fertilizer, 20 ~ 30 parts of mica, zeolite
10 ~ 15 parts and 10 ~ 15 parts of vermiculite.
Preferably, the step(5)Middle garlic and corn are sowed using interval, and 3 row garlics and 1 row corn are separately broadcast
Kind.
Preferably, the step(6)Also emerged including human assistance in field management, to minority can not voluntarily rupture of membranes children
Seedling, the broken mulch film of small hook hook is curved with iron wire, and seedling is pulled out.
Preferably, the step(6)Also include the prevention and control of plant diseases, pest control in field management, hundred are used to garlic leaf blight, leaf spot
The clear wettable powder preventing and treating of bacterium, subterranean pest-insect phoxim pouring root.
Preferably, the step(6)In garlic special fertilizer by weight, including 60 ~ 80 parts of biogas waste residue, leaf 60
~ 80 parts, 30 ~ 50 parts of plant ash, 30 ~ 50 parts of wheat stalk, 20 ~ 30 parts of traditional Chinese medicinal components, 15 ~ 20 parts of potassium sulfate, Diammonium phosphate (DAP) 10 ~
15 parts and 10 ~ 15 parts of urea.
Preferably, the traditional Chinese medicinal components by weight, including 15 ~ 20 parts of black false hellebore, 15 ~ 20 parts of trifoliate jewelvine, Celastrus angulatus 10 ~ 15
5 ~ 10 parts of part, 10 ~ 15 parts of thunder godvine, 5 ~ 10 parts of corter pseudolaricis, 5 ~ 10 parts of Kadsura Root-bark and granatum.
Preferably, the step(6)In corn fertilizer by weight, including 50 ~ 60 parts of plant ash, urea 30 ~
10 ~ 15 parts of 40 parts, 20 ~ 30 parts of cushaw stem, 10 ~ 15 parts of Chicken dung and vermiculite.
Beneficial effects of the present invention:Rationally using garlic and the advantage of corn, the defect of respective presence is effectively avoided,
On the basis of garlic production promoting, interplanting corn, while the quality and yield of corn and garlic is improved, it is specific as follows:
(1), garlic and corn interplanting, using each different growth periods, make full use of the time and space for staggering, it is to avoid
Interrow crop strive water, strive fertilizer, the contradiction such as win honour for, so that win-win progress, reaches high yield jointly;
(2), the inventive method it is simple, have the advantages that low cost, recovery rate be high, convenient management, be adapted to large-scale promotion application;
(3), be coated using corn seed-dressing agent special, seed coat agent is formed uniform film in corn seed outer layer, promote beautiful
Meter Sheng Chang, the incidence of disease for reducing rough dwarf disease, prevention smut of maize, leaf rust, subterranean pest-insect and the plague of rats;
(4), garlic in growth course, the requirement to moisture fertilizer is higher, garlic special fertilizer, base manure and soil improvement
The use of agent, significantly improves the microecosystem environment of soil, enhances the gas permeability of soil and Water and fertilizer retention ability of soil,
The ability of the sustainable increasing both production and income of soil is improve, and contains traditional Chinese medicinal components in garlic special fertilizer, the effect with desinsection,
Avoid the insect pest in later stage.
